Riedel Launches RefSuite Ecosystem For Sports Officiating, Coaching, And Production

Riedel Communications has announced the launch of RefSuite, a powerful new Managed Technology solution tailored to professional sports workflows. RefSuite combines hardware, software, cloud services, and 24/7 remote operations into one seamless ecosystem designed to transform refereeing, coaching, and broadcast operations across live sports environments.
Developed in close partnership with referees and industry stakeholders — and built on Riedel’s trusted engineering expertise — RefSuite brings together five tightly integrated modules: RefCam, RefBox, RefComms, CoachComms, and RefCloud. From head-mounted referee cameras and FIFA Quality-certified Video Assistant Referee (VAR) systems to Bolero S-based wireless comms and cloud-based media management, RefSuite enables unprecedented coordination, performance, and decision-making while delivering unseen/immersive broadcast perspectives.
RefSuite’s modular design ensures maximum scalability and flexibility; whether deployed at elite-level tournaments, national leagues, or training grounds, RefSuite adapts to each client’s requirements and scale. RefCam delivers stabilized, broadcast-grade referee POV video, while the RefBox VAR review system offers intuitive, synchronous control of all video sources for instant analysis, playback, and clip export. RefComms and CoachComms provide encrypted, low-latency referee and team communication, complemented by the RefCloud media cloud as a central hub for secure media storage, review, and collaboration.
The ecosystem can be extended with Riedel’s Easy5G Private 5G network solution, offering high-speed, secure data transmission for full-pitch RefCam video streaming or remote RefBox review workflows. Combined with (optional) centralized monitoring and support via Riedel’s Remote Operations Center (ROC), this Managed Technology offering delivers turnkey deployment and operational peace of mind.
